Transaction 41834299a427f7250c02f5d267a01807dda331a48abe431f66e389d6dbe9d22c
1 Input
1 Output
-
41834299a427f7250c02f5d267a01807dda331a48abe431f66e389d6dbe9d22c:0
- value
- 533936
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daea67c8d6602c03fadd0236229c9858d6fd80ec OP_EQUAL
- address
- 3MeY38r2MpmzX5qJJA91tJLz3vZb7dPraS